How Type 2 Diabetes Medications Enhance Quality of Life

Type II diabetes is a lifetime disease that requires patients to follow continuous medication.  Managing type II diabetes effectively avoids health complications. Taking medication at an early stage controls the blood sugar levels to normal, improves the life quality, and reduces complication risk.

Causes

Insulin resistance and the production of insufficient hormones cause Type II diabetes condition.  The causes include obesity and other lifestyle factors like physical inactivity and poor diet.

Diagnosing and preventing the onset of type II diabetes as early as possible is important to avoid stroke-related complications. Early diagnosis is relied upon with appropriate medications and lifestyle changes through routine health exams and screenings.

Maintaining Balanced Blood Sugar

The main thing is that early intervention with type II diabetes medications brings More stable blood sugar levels. Prolonged hyperglycemia leads to symptoms of thirst, urination more than usual at night time and during the day, and causes blurred vision. If not managed, prolonged periods of uncontrolled blood sugar result in damage to the eyes, kidneys, and nerves.

Type II diabetes medications keep the blood sugar levels stable by improving insulin response or increasing production. Starting at an early stage can help in controlling the blood sugar level.

Preventing Complications

Prolonged high blood sugar can damage vessels and nerves of the entire body causing diabetic retinopathy, neuropathy, nephropathy, and cardiovascular disease. The common complication that affects sugar patients is irreversible blindness from diabetic retinopathy. This condition causes high blood sugar levels in small blood vessels in the retina.

The diabetic condition that occurs in adults is neuropathy disorder which results in damaging neurological cells and tissues. The symptoms of neuropathy cause patients to experience severe pain and a sudden lack of sensation in their hands and feet. Controlling your blood sugar on time with appropriate medications will reduce damage to nerves.

Prevent Stroke

People with type II diabetes have a higher risk of death from heart attacks and strokes.  Taking medications controls glucose levels, blood pressure, and cholesterol management to reduce cardiovascular risks.

Enhance Life Quality

Type II diabetes has More serious effects on the quality of life of these individuals. It can be extremely difficult to handle the physical symptoms, psychological stress, and lifestyle restrictions that accompany this condition.

Proper Medications can improve the quality of life, allowing sugar patients to live an active and normal lifestyle. Diabetes management includes regular monitoring of blood sugar levels, a healthy diet, and exercise with proper medication.

Reduce Symptoms

Symptoms of uncontrolled blood sugar levels include high blood glucose range, excessive thirst, and frequent need for urination. Following appropriate medication can relieve these symptoms, allowing individuals to lead better everyday lives. The improvement in symptoms leads to increased energy levels, better concentration, and overall enhanced well-being.

Improved Mental Health

A chronic disease such as type 2 diabetes affects a patient’s mental health more. The demands of monitoring blood sugar levels, dietary control, and physical activity, along with medication management, can cause psychological distress such as anxiety and depression.  Effective diabetes management through medication reduces mental stress and promotes overall better mental health for patients.
